- Characters
- Fredric Wertham; Len Darvin; Al Hewetson; Herschel Waldman; Skywald staffers; Heap; Frankenstein's Monster
- Synopsis
- Featured lead characters based on ‘Seduction Of The Innocent’ author Fredric Wertham and Comics Code Authority president Len Darvin as well as Al Hewetson, Herschel Waldman & other Skywald staffers. In the story Darvin and Wertham visit the Skywald offices to complain about the horror comics being published, get into an argument and kill Hewetson whereupon tiny versions of Skywald’s Heap, Frankenstein’s Monster and others come off comic pages in the Skywald offices and kill Wertham and Darvin.
- Reprints
Hewetson sent a copy of the story to Wertham, with whom he corresponded for a number of years but, according to Hewetson, Wertham didn’t get the point.
